0 ) { array_map('intval', $idChecked); $idChecked = implode(',',$idChecked); } if (!empty($idChecked)) { Database::query("DELETE FROM $tbl_session_rel_course_rel_user WHERE id_session='$id_session' AND course_code='".$course_code."' AND id_user IN($idChecked)"); $nbr_affected_rows = Database::affected_rows(); Database::query("UPDATE $tbl_session_rel_course SET nbr_users=nbr_users-$nbr_affected_rows WHERE id_session='$id_session' AND course_code='".$course_code."'"); } header('Location: '.api_get_self().'?id_session='.$id_session.'&course_code='.urlencode($course_code).'&sort='.$sort); exit(); break; case 'add': SessionManager::subscribe_users_to_session_course($idChecked, $id_session, $course_code); header('Location: '.api_get_self().'?id_session='.$id_session.'&course_code='.urlencode($course_code).'&sort='.$sort); exit; break; } $limit = 20; $from = $page * $limit; $is_western_name_order = api_is_western_name_order(); //scru.status<>2 scru.course_code='".$course_code."' $sql = "SELECT DISTINCT u.user_id,".($is_western_name_order ? 'u.firstname, u.lastname' : 'u.lastname, u.firstname').", u.username, scru.id_user as is_subscribed FROM $tbl_session_rel_user s INNER JOIN $tbl_user u ON (u.user_id=s.id_user) LEFT JOIN $tbl_session_rel_course_rel_user scru ON (u.user_id=scru.id_user AND scru.course_code = '".$course_code."' ) WHERE s.id_session='$id_session' ORDER BY $sort $direction LIMIT $from,".($limit+1); if ($direction == 'desc') { $direction = 'asc'; } else { $direction = 'desc'; } $result = Database::query($sql); $Users = Database::store_result($result); $nbr_results = sizeof($Users); $tool_name = get_lang('Session').': '.$session_name.' - '.get_lang('Course').': '.$course_title; $interbreadcrumb[] = array("url" => "index.php","name" => get_lang('PlatformAdmin')); $interbreadcrumb[] = array("url" => "session_list.php","name" => get_lang('SessionList')); $interbreadcrumb[] = array('url' => "resume_session.php?id_session=".$id_session,"name" => get_lang('SessionOverview')); //$interbreadcrumb[]=array("url" => "session_course_list.php?id_session=$id_session","name" => get_lang('ListOfCoursesOfSession')." "".api_htmlentities($session_name,ENT_QUOTES,$charset)."""); Display::display_header($tool_name); echo Display::page_header($tool_name); ?>